Sea Sailing

What if I let it all go
and sailed with the moon for a while?
Would anyone miss me enough
to come and fly too?
to leave the world on the ground and keep my
heart safe up with me in the sky's depths...
melting into the paper thin clouds
becoming one of the sea's friends
as I catch my reflection in it's eyes.
Just me and the water above and below.
tracing my finger along it's silver surface,
it caresses me in return.
salt and air filling my senses
with pure white noise
until there isn't room for the crazy chaos
of land.
on the bow of my vessel
I'll stand alone.
daring the ocean tides to take me anywhere.
There's no place left that can strike me with fear,
the unknown being a thrill to the beholder.
the bare plains of flat nothing,
the inclement icy depths of the north,
careless dancing trees and winds.
angel's singing my theme,
while I strain to pick out the one I miss the most...
the rush of chase
and chance...
being the power in my sails.
